What are LittleBits?

Power (Blue): Power Bits, plus a power supply, run power through your circuit

Wire (Orange): Wire Bits connect to other systems and let you build circuits in new directions (these are your logic gates)

Input (Pink): Input Bits accept input from you or the environment and send signals that affect the Bits that follow

Output (Green): Output Bits do something- light up, buzz, move...
